In all the cases, the reset causes a ~10 second delay during which: - VF must reinitialize completely - Any in-progress operations (like bonding enslave) fail with timeouts - VF is unavailable When granting trust, no reset is needed - we can just set the capability flag to allow privileged operations. When revoking trust, we only need to reset (conservative approach) if the VF has actually configured advanced features that require cleanup (ADQ/cloud filters, promiscuous mode). For VFs in a clean state, we can safely change the trust setting without the disruptive reset. When we don't reset, we manually handle capability flag via helper function, eliminating the delay.
